If your car is experiencing engine problems, such as misfiring, difficulty starting, or poor acceleration, the ignition coil may be the culprit. The ignition coil is responsible for converting the vehicle’s low-voltage electrical current into a high-voltage current that is used to create the spark that ignites the air-fuel mixture in the engine’s cylinders. Over time, ignition coils can fail due to wear and tear or heat damage, leading to a variety of performance issues.

One way to test the ignition coil is to use a multimeter. A multimeter is a versatile tool that can be used to measure voltage, current, and resistance. To test the ignition coil, you will need to set the multimeter to the ohms setting. Once the multimeter is set, you will need to disconnect the ignition coil from the engine. Next, you will need to connect the multimeter’s probes to the ignition coil’s terminals. If the ignition coil is functioning properly, the multimeter will read between 0.5 and 2 ohms. If the multimeter reads infinity, the ignition coil is open and needs to be replaced. If the multimeter reads 0 ohms, the ignition coil is shorted and also needs to be replaced.

How to Test Ignition Coil with Multimeter

Ignition coils are essential components of a vehicle’s ignition system, providing the electrical spark needed to ignite the air-fuel mixture in the engine. When an ignition coil fails, it can lead to a variety of engine issues, including misfires, rough idling, and difficulty starting.

Testing an ignition coil with a multimeter is a relatively simple procedure that can help you identify a faulty coil. Here are the steps involved:

  1. Gather your tools. You will need a multimeter, a spark plug wire tester or a screwdriver with a flathead, and a pair of gloves.
  2. Wear gloves for safety. Ignition coils can become very hot during operation, so it is important to wear gloves to protect your hands.
  3. Disconnect the ignition coil. Locate the ignition coil and disconnect the electrical connectors. On most vehicles, there will be two or three connectors: one for power, one for ground, and one for the tachometer signal.
  4. Set the multimeter to ohms. You will be using the multimeter to measure the resistance of the ignition coil.
  5. Connect the multimeter probes. Connect one probe to each of the terminals on the ignition coil. If you are using a spark plug wire tester, connect the tester to the ignition coil wire.
  6. Read the multimeter display. The multimeter will display the resistance of the ignition coil.
  7. Compare the reading to the specifications. The specifications for the ignition coil can be found in your vehicle’s service manual.
  8. Interpret the results.
    If the resistance reading is within the specifications, the ignition coil is functioning properly. If the resistance reading is outside of the specifications, the ignition coil is likely faulty.

How To Replace Toner In Brother Printer

Replacing the toner in your Brother printer is a simple process that can be completed in a few minutes. Here are the steps on how to do it:

  1. Open the front cover of the printer. The front cover is usually held in place by a latch or lever. Locate the latch or lever and release it to open the cover.
  2. Remove the old toner cartridge. The toner cartridge is located inside the printer, behind the front cover. Grasp the toner cartridge by the handle and pull it straight out of the printer.
  3. Unpack the new toner cartridge. Remove the new toner cartridge from its packaging. Be careful not to touch the green roller on the bottom of the cartridge.
  4. Insert the new toner cartridge. Align the new toner cartridge with the tracks inside the printer. Push the toner cartridge into the printer until it clicks into place.
  5. Close the front cover of the printer. Once the new toner cartridge is in place, close the front cover of the printer.
